Two more Middenlanders today...
First is from the Marauder MM60 Fighters range. He was F8 and released in 1988.
Next is Georg Lightfoot from the 1987 F2 Fighters range...
Finally the warband so far...

Dwarf Supply Train... made up using the Adventurers Pony from BC1, two converted Citadel War of the Roses horses and the Mounted Gimli along with three Dwarfs on foot including Borinn Fimbull from the Orcs Drift campaign, a C06 veteran from 1985 and then two Dwarf adventurers/miners from 1987.
